Does anyone know how to modify the 32 bit driver for this USB Wireless adapter TEW-424UB (Version 3.1R) to work on Snow 64 bit.

 

I got it to work in 32 bit kernel space I downloaded old driver for Leopard and opened .kext file and edited plist of it to new bundle numbers and it worked!

 

Now I am sure someone out there could make it work under 64 bit kernel space?  

 

Are there any out of box solutions that work now with 64 bit snow?  I need 64 bit because of pro applications I use so need  all 8 gig of rams to be used by one application.
